Abstract
Healthy family functioning provides the foundation for members’ cognitive, emotional, and relational development. The Beavers Systems Model, with its emphasis on the developmental nature of family functioning, offers a process-oriented assessment framework capable of identifying both individual and family developmental challenges. The purpose of the present research was to restructure validate make reliable and normalize the self-reported family inventory (SFI). In this testing research, 313 married female students were enrolled from various faculties of the Islamic Azad University, Science and Research Branch, Tehran, via cluster random sampling. Following an evaluation of face and content validity, Item analysis such as item discrimination and internal consistency indices, construct validation (factor analysis) and reliability analysis (Cronbach Alpha) were utilized. The findings indicated acceptable face and content validity for the instrument. Exploratory factor analysis yielded three factors: health/competence, Family Emotional Conflict, and Interactional Conflict. The reliability of the whole scale was confirmed with a Cronbach's alpha value of 0/905.The normalization results showed that T-scores < 35, T-scores > 65, and T-scores > 60 indicate optimal family functioning for the first, second, and third factors, respectively. Overall, the results suggest that the reconstructed SFI possesses satisfactory validity and reliability in the Iranian cultural context, and that the extracted factors provide an appropriate structure for the assessment of family functioning.
